About the Walking Trail

A short stroll from the carpark down the headland to reveal Admirals Arch, a significant geological formation. View the pounding waves of the Southern Ocean. As you walk down, watch out for long nosed fur seals basking in the sun on the rocks. The boardwalk descends stairs down into a bay before emerging in Admirals Arch, where viewing platforms allow you to watch the seals closer.

The walk begins in the lower carpark, below the lighthouse.

The first 3/4 of the walk is wheelchair accessible along the wide boardwalk, before the path descends down stairs into the arch. The views along the boardwalk make the walk worthwhile even if you can’t head down the stairs to see Admirals Arch.
